In the context of Davidic royalty, this verse captures a profound declaration about the nature of the Messiah. Written by David, it presents a divine dialogue between God and David's "Lord," who Christian tradition identifies as Jesus Christ. The phrase "sit at my right hand" signifies a position of ultimate authority and honor, symbolizing the power vested in the Messiah after His ascension. The psalm showcases not only the king's authority but also a prophetic foreshadowing of Jesus' role in the New Testament, highlighted by references throughout Scripture, including Acts and Hebrews.
This verse serves as a critical lens through which to understand Jesus' identity as both David's descendant and divine Lord, thus affirming the belief in His preexistence and the Trinity. The assertion that God promises to make the Messiah's enemies a footstool underscores God's sovereignty and the eventual triumph of Christ over opposition. This powerful imagery challenges believers to recognize the kingly authority of Christ and inspires hope for His ultimate victory in the face of adversity, affirming the duality of His roles as King and Priest, and invoking themes from various Tough Topics such as authority and divine sovereignty.
Psalms 110:1
Psalms 110:1
Ask The Bible Says
Welcome to The Bible Says. I'm an AI Assistant that can answer your questions. Ask me anything about our commentaries.
Ask The Bible Says
Welcome to The Bible Says. I'm an AI Assistant that can answer your questions. Ask me anything about our commentaries.
Psalms 110:1 meaning
In the context of Davidic royalty, this verse captures a profound declaration about the nature of the Messiah. Written by David, it presents a divine dialogue between God and David's "Lord," who Christian tradition identifies as Jesus Christ. The phrase "sit at my right hand" signifies a position of ultimate authority and honor, symbolizing the power vested in the Messiah after His ascension. The psalm showcases not only the king's authority but also a prophetic foreshadowing of Jesus' role in the New Testament, highlighted by references throughout Scripture, including Acts and Hebrews.
This verse serves as a critical lens through which to understand Jesus' identity as both David's descendant and divine Lord, thus affirming the belief in His preexistence and the Trinity. The assertion that God promises to make the Messiah's enemies a footstool underscores God's sovereignty and the eventual triumph of Christ over opposition. This powerful imagery challenges believers to recognize the kingly authority of Christ and inspires hope for His ultimate victory in the face of adversity, affirming the duality of His roles as King and Priest, and invoking themes from various Tough Topics such as authority and divine sovereignty.